Kymco Zing II 125 - 2013 Specifications and Reviews

The 2013 Kymco Zing II 125 is a compact cruiser-style motorcycle designed for entry-level and budget-conscious riders seeking an affordable commuter with classic styling. Powered by a 124cc single-cylinder four-stroke engine delivering modest performance, it excels as a reliable, fuel-efficient urban runabout. Best known for delivering practical everyday transportation with retro cruiser aesthetics at an accessible price point.

Rider Profile

Best ForThis is an easygoing, beginner-friendly small cruiser that suits new or returning riders comfortable with modest power.
PurposeIt is built as a low-cost, small-displacement cruiser-styled commuter for relaxed city and suburban riding rather than performance.
Rider FitThe low seat height and light dry weight make it accessible to riders of shorter stature or those wanting a manageable, non-intimidating machine.
CharacterIt has a laid-back custom cruiser look paired with modest single-cylinder performance, prioritizing style and ease of use over speed.
Not Ideal ForThis is not the bike for riders seeking highway touring comfort, sustained high speeds, or any off-road capability.
